I recently won an auction on eBay for a new water pump for my washing machine. So I signed up for a paypal account to send payment to the guy. I clicked on his "paypal" link on the auction page and then submitted the payment to him. Here's a link to the auction. His user ID is qfjewelry and the email account I sent it to on Paypal was jon@quickfixjewelry.com.

Well he writes me back and tells me I sent it to the wrong email or account or something.
Here's his email:
Hi,
This is Jon The seller of the pump, you have send the money to an closed
paypal accunt bymistack , please send the money to this email account ,
jon9989@verizon.com. Any questions email me.
Sincerely,
Jon andoyan

And this email was sent from jon.aa@verizon.net. His eBay sellers email is listed as auctionlistings@quickfixjewelry.com. So thats 4 different emails this guy has for dealing with this one eBay auction.

So what should I do now? This seems a little fishy to me. It wasn't my mistake since he had that email address linked in the auction. The money transfer is listed as "uncleared" in my Paypal account. This is my first dealing with Paypal...is there a way to cancel this transaction? Then I could resend it to the new email address. I really don't want a negative feedback since I am new to eBay. Should I trust him and submit the payment again and hope that paypal is smart enough to cancel the first one since its not a valid account?

*sigh* Another ebay question. Do NOT send it again. NOT NOT NOT. Do NOT. Under NO circumstance do you send him another payment w/o confirmation that the first payment was cancelled. If he refuses to send the pump, then take it up with ebay or your local wanker.

Don't send another payment till the first has been cancelled. Since it is uncleared, you may still be able to cancel it. If not, either you and/or the seller will need to email paypal to get this cleared up.

I would only send money to the account listed on the auction - even if you cancel the first payment. Sounds fishy to me.
